Code Aster
Version installée = 15.2.0
Attention :
- cette version est une version "testing"
- Il s’agit de la version openmp, on ne peut l’utiliser que sur un seul nœud (pas de mpi)
Utilisation
Pour initialiser l’environnement :
module purge module load code-aster/15.2.0
Utilisation à partir d’un script batch :
Il est important de définir les paramètres rep_trav
et proxy_dir
, sinon des fichiers sont créés dans le /tmp des machines, ce qui risque d’entraîner par la suite des dysfonctionnements.
Voici un extrait de script dont vous pouvez vous inspirer :
mkdir $SLURM_JOB_ID $SLURM_JOB_ID/tmp cp fichier.export $SLURM_JOB_ID cd $SLURM_JOB_ID mv fichier.export fichier.export.orig echo "P rep_trav ${pwd}/tmp" >> fichier.export echo "P proxy_dir ${pwd}/tmp" >> fichier.export grep -vE "P rep_trav|P proxy_dir" fichier.export.orig >>fichier.export # Exécution de code_aster (as_run n'est pas dans le path) /usr/local/aster/15.2.0/bin/as_run ${CASE} > aster.log
Utilisation à partir de python
Vous pouvez aussi utiliser code-aster en écrivant un code en python :
import code_aster code_aster.init() from code_aster.Commands import * ...
Salome
Le programme de visualisation de données salome est également installé :
Il s’utilise à partir de la visu :
module load salome/9.6.0 salome